Kannon Day • January

Prostrations, chanting, and incense offerings to honor and express gratitude to the Bodhisattva of Compassion.

Parinirvana Buddha

Parinirvana Ceremony • February

A sitting which concludes with a special chanting service and an account of the Buddha’s entry into final nirvana.

Temple Night Altar

Temple Nights • April

Two evenings of unstructured devotional activities with beautifully adorned altars in the Buddha Hall.

Jukai altar

Jukai • April and November

Formal ceremony of entering the Buddha's Way. Repentance Ceremony; chanting; “incense offering”; taking the Sixteen Precepts.

Roshi Kapleau Memorial

Roshi Kapleau Memorial • May

A half-day Sunday sitting with chanting, special services, and a taped teisho from the archive of Roshi Kapleau’s talks.

The Buddha’s Birthday, Vesak • May

Offerings made by participants; story and play of the Buddha's birth; elephant parade; Jataka tales; pot-luck picnic with birthday cake; presents for all children. See gallery.

Jizo Bodhisattvas

Water Baby Ceremony • August

Ceremony for those who have died through miscarriage, stillbirth, and abortion. Tiny garments are sewn and placed on Jizo figures. Chants and offerings are made.

Vermont Zen Center

World Peace Day • September

Chanting services devoted to Peace on Earth. All the countries and geographical areas are recited with the peace prayer, “May Peace Prevail on Earth.”

Bodhidharma altar

Bodhidharma Day • October

Honoring the Founder of Zen. Zazen, special chanting service with offerings.

Hungry Ghost Altar

Hungry Ghost Ceremony • October

Special Hungry Ghost Altar set up for receiving food and water offerings; Hungry Ghost play; chanting; trick-or-treating; party.

enso

Oxfam Fast Day • November

Ceremony with zazen followed by chanting, prostrations and circumambulation. Monetary and food donations for hunger relief.

Thanksgiving altar

Thanksgiving • November

Beautiful ceremony of gratitude with food offerings; chanting; circumambulation.

The Buddha

Rohatsu • December

Seven-day sesshin starts with special ceremony honoring the Buddha’s Enlightenment, including a special reading, chanting and sutra “tossing.”

New Year's Eve Welcome

New Year’s Eve • December 31

Zazen; Repentance Ceremony; reading of resolutions; incense offerings at altars; driving out of demons circumambulation with noise-making; Precepts ceremony; candle-lighting ceremony; New Year's prayer; and more.

wedding

Other Ceremonies & Services

Ceremonies of Aid; Famine Relief Ceremonies; weddings, naming ceremonies for babies, memorial services and funerals. See gallery.

The Vermont Zen Center was founded in 1988 to provide a peaceful environment for the study and practice of Zen Buddhism. The Center is dedicated to helping people overcome suffering through spiritual development and social outreach.
